The Search

After 12 years our toaster has died. It no longer will toast anything at any level. So we put that one to rest in the garbage and went off to Target. Who would guess there are so many different types of toasters. 4 slice, 2 slice, chrome, white, black, some that are wide, and have fancy frozen and bagel buttons. I just wanted a simple toaster, you know the kind that makes um toast. So after some thought we decided on a more expensive one that was a 4 slice with a bagel button. I know we are fancy! We brought this beauty home all shiny and new and only one side works. So the 4 slice is really 2 slice. How is this possible, the toaster is brand new and fancy with buttons. So back into the fancy packaging and off the Target we go. This time I will not be fooled. I picked up the simplest, most inexpensive white toaster I could find. After all our last one was inexpensive, white with no fancy buttons. Again ride home with some excitement, I am simple, I love buying new appliances even if it was only $8.00. Get it out of the plastic and cardboard, get my bread all ready for its new home. Throw in the bread and what is this, it does not fit. It leaves about 1 inch of the top of the bread out of the toaster. Now this is not big bread, just normal sized everyday bread. BOO! Okay fine, but after burning 3 pieces trying to find the right number for my huge bread I am done. I just want a piece of toast. So this one goes back into its not so fancy packaging and we again search for the perfect toaster. This time we will try Costco. Where we find a 2 slice, chrome, type of rounded shape toaster. It looks like a toaster, the bread in the picture looks like it fits and it too has fancy buttons. We trudge home, get out our enormous bread and pop it in. We have success! It fits, it works and I have myself a nice piece of toast. Our search is done, now lets hope this one lasts 12 years too.
